#2CCFED Hex color

#2CCFED

The hexadecimal color code #2CCFED corresponds to the code RGB( 44, 207, 237 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,17 level), green (at 0,81 level) and blue (at 0,93 level). Its brightness is 55% and its saturation is 84%. It is composed of red at 9%, green at 42% and blue at 48%.

Uses of #2CCFED in CSS

When using #2CCFED as the background color, consider selecting a darker text color for improved readability. If you want to use #2CCFED as the text color, prefer a dark background, such as Black.
